How to Match Pin Shear Strength to Your Rig
Pin shear strength is the measure of the force required to snap the pin across its axis, and it is a critical safety consideration for any load-bearing equipment. If the weight of the ladder combined with the impact force of hitting a bump exceeds the pin’s shear strength, the mechanism will fail.
Always calculate the weight of your ladder, and remember that dynamic forces (the bounce of the vehicle) can multiply that weight significantly. Choose a pin with a shear rating that is at least double your static load to account for these road-induced forces. When in doubt, err on the side of a higher diameter pin or a stronger alloy.
Consult technical documentation provided by the manufacturer to identify the material’s shear strength rating. Do not substitute hardware store pins if you cannot verify their load-bearing capacity. Matching your hardware to the rig’s weight is the most basic step in preventing a mid-trail equipment failure.
Choosing Between Stainless Steel and Aluminum
The debate between stainless steel and aluminum often comes down to the balance between weight and corrosion resistance. Stainless steel is incredibly strong and highly resistant to rust, making it the superior choice for heavy-duty, long-term applications.
Aluminum pins are significantly lighter, which appeals to those obsessed with reducing total vehicle weight to improve fuel economy. However, aluminum is softer and more prone to deformation under extreme stress compared to steel. In a high-vibration off-road environment, steel pins are generally the safer bet for critical connections.
Evaluate the environment and the frequency of use when making the final decision. If the ladder is removed and stored inside the vehicle regularly, the weight savings of aluminum may be worth it. If the ladder is permanently mounted and exposed to the elements, prioritize the durability and strength of stainless steel.
Keeping Quick Release Pins Free of Trail Dirt
The most common point of failure for quick-release pins is the buildup of fine dust, sand, and dried mud within the locking mechanism. Even high-quality pins will seize if the spring-loaded detents are packed with grit.
Adopt a routine of cleaning the pins after every major trip, especially those involving dry, dusty desert trails. Use a dry lubricant, like a PTFE-based spray, to coat the pins after cleaning; avoid thick greases that attract and hold onto more dust. Keeping the mechanism clean ensures that the locking ball stays mobile and secure.
If the pins become stuck in the field, a quick blast of compressed air or a light application of solvent can usually free them. Never force a stuck pin with a hammer, as this can damage the internal spring or the mount. Regular, simple maintenance will ensure that your modular system remains as efficient as the day you installed it.
Crucial Safety Checks Before Bearing Weight
Before hitting the highway, perform a physical inspection of every quick-release pin in your system. Ensure the locking ball has fully retracted and snapped back out into its seated position, which indicates a positive engagement.
Verify that there is no excessive “wobble” or movement between the ladder and the bracket; if the ladder is loose, the vibration will accelerate wear on the pin. If you notice any signs of bending, cracking, or if the spring tension feels weak, replace the pin immediately. These components are inexpensive compared to the potential cost of a ladder detaching while in motion.
Finally, consider using a secondary safety strap or a locking clip as a redundancy. While quick-release pins are strong, a simple nylon strap provides a backup should the pin accidentally release during a high-impact event. Checking these connections should be part of every pre-departure walk-around, just like checking your tire pressure or roof rack bolts.
